About Annie

Annie is a delightful 7-year-old Beagle/Harrier mix who weighs about 35 pounds. This affectionate girl loves nothing more than snuggling with her humans. Annie is gentle and gets along well with both people and other dogs. She does have a playful side, and while she’s known to be a bit of a counter-surfer when food is involved, she’s only a pro if it’s within reach. In addition to being house-trained, Annie enjoys regular exercise and thrives on love and attention. She has a protective nature and will alert you when someone approaches your home, but her barking is friendly rather than aggressive. Finding her a loving home where she can receive the affection she deserves is the top priority for her current family. Located in Mechanicsburg, PA, Annie is eager to meet her forever family.
